About This Book
The sweet scent of candy hearts fills the air as Sunny sets out to make Valentine's Day sparkle brighter than ever. Her hopeful heart beats fast with big plans to create a special Kid's Day that everyone will love. But with old troubles popping up and new challenges ahead, can Sunny keep shining and spread joy to all around her?

Quick Assessment
This middle-grade fiction follows third-grader Sunny as she navigates various challenges while striving to create a new holiday, Kid's Day, and enhance Valentine's Day celebrations. Themes of self-confidence, family relationships, and school life are gently explored, making it suitable for readers aged 9-12. The story promotes positivity and resilience without intense conflict or mature content.
Why we rated Sunny Holiday #2 9LE
Sunny Holiday #2 is written at a Level 4-5 reading level across 178 pages. Strong independent readers around grade 5.5 can typically handle this book on their own; with parent or teacher support, Sunny Holiday #2 works for readers up to grade 6.5.
We rate Sunny Holiday #2 as 9LE ("Light — Emotional") because the content sits in the "Mild" range — mild conflict — the kind a child encounters in normal play and sibling life. Across our four dimensions (emotional, physical, social, thematic) the book reads as evenly mild; no single dimension stands out as a concern.
No specific content flags were raised by community reviewers, which is consistent with the mild intensity score.
Thematically, Sunny Holiday #2 explores holidays, self-confidence, family, and school — these threads give the book room to mean different things to different readers.
